5个理由让Sticky成为你Linux桌面必备的高效便签工具
在Linux系统中,寻找一款既轻量又功能完备的信息管理工具并非易事。Sticky桌面便签作为Linux环境下的高效信息管理解决方案,以极简设计承载强大功能,让你的碎片化信息井井有条,工作效率倍增。无论是临时记录、任务管理还是灵感捕捉,它都能成为你桌面上最得力的数字助手。
核心价值:为什么选择Sticky桌面便签?
Sticky便签工具通过独特的设计理念,解决了传统笔记应用"功能冗余"与"操作繁琐"的痛点。它像真实便签一样直观,又具备数字化工具的灵活特性,实现了"随手记录-即时访问-智能管理"的完整闭环。
📌 轻量不简单
仅占用10MB系统资源,启动速度<2秒,即使同时打开多个便签也不会拖慢系统。采用Python与GTK3构建,完美融合Linux桌面环境,提供原生应用般的操作体验。
📌 所见即所得
无需复杂设置,启动即可创建便签。所有编辑实时保存,意外关闭也不会丢失内容。支持文本格式化、颜色分类和拖放排序,让信息组织一目了然。
📌 专注无干扰
没有多余功能打扰,界面简洁到只剩下内容本身。可随时隐藏到系统托盘,需要时一键呼出,让你在专注工作与信息记录间无缝切换。
场景应用:这些情境下Sticky能帮你大忙
程序员的代码片段库
🔍 使用情境:调试过程中遇到的正则表达式、API参数或临时解决方案,用不同颜色便签分类保存,右侧屏幕固定显示,随时参考无需切换窗口。
项目管理看板
🔍 使用情境:将项目任务分解为多个便签,用颜色区分优先级(红=紧急,黄=进行中,绿=已完成),桌面直观展示项目进度,拖拽调整顺序轻松规划工作流。
学习笔记整理
🔍 使用情境:阅读技术文档时,将关键概念和公式分别记录在不同便签,排列在屏幕边缘,形成可视化知识图谱,复习时一目了然。
会议记录助手
🔍 使用情境:会议中快速记录要点和待办事项,即时分配责任人,会后拖放归类,自动保存特性确保不错过任何重要信息。
快速上手:3步完成Sticky安装部署
方法一:源码编译安装(推荐)
# 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/stic/sticky
# 进入项目目录并编译
cd sticky && dpkg-buildpackage --no-sign
# 安装生成的deb包
cd .. && sudo dpkg -i sticky*.deb
执行效果:系统将自动处理依赖关系并完成安装,程序会出现在应用菜单的"办公"分类下。
方法二:直接文件部署
sudo cp -r usr/* /usr/
sudo cp etc/xdg/autostart/sticky.desktop /etc/xdg/autostart/
执行效果:该方法适合快速测试,文件将被直接复制到系统标准目录,重启后即可使用。
深度技巧:5个提升效率的隐藏功能
💡 全局快捷键操作
按下Ctrl+Alt+N快速创建新便签,Ctrl+Alt+H隐藏/显示所有便签,无需鼠标操作即可完成常用功能。
💡 颜色标签系统
右键点击便签标题栏选择颜色,建立个人化分类规则:蓝色记录代码、绿色记录想法、黄色记录待办,视觉化信息管理更高效。
💡 DBus命令控制
通过命令行创建和管理便签,适合高级用户和脚本自动化:
# 创建带有标题和内容的便签
dbus-send --type=method_call --dest="org.x.sticky" /org/x/sticky org.x.sticky.CreateNote string:"会议记录" string:"讨论了新项目时间表"
💡 自定义样式
编辑/usr/share/sticky/sticky.css文件修改外观:
- 调整
#note { font-size: 14px; }更改字体大小 - 修改
background-color属性自定义便签颜色 - 添加
box-shadow属性增加立体效果
💡 自动备份策略
定期导出便签数据:
- 打开Sticky设置
- 选择"数据管理"
- 设置每周自动备份到指定目录
- 勾选"备份加密"保护敏感信息
问题解决:常见困扰的解决方案
依赖缺失错误
症状:编译时提示缺少gir1.2-xapp-1.0
解决:执行sudo apt-get install gir1.2-xapp-1.0安装依赖,或使用apt-get build-dep .自动解决所有编译依赖。
便签不显示在任务栏
原因:系统托盘设置问题
解决:在系统设置→通知区域中,确保"Sticky"被设置为"始终显示"。
启动速度慢
优化方案:
- 减少同时显示的便签数量(建议不超过8个)
- 清理内容过多的大型便签
- 禁用不必要的拼写检查功能
主题兼容性问题
解决:如果便签显示异常,在设置中切换到"系统默认主题",或手动修改CSS文件适配当前主题。
Sticky桌面便签以其独特的"轻量而不简单"理念,在众多Linux笔记工具中脱颖而出。它不追求功能大而全,而是专注于做好信息记录与管理的核心需求。无论是编程开发、学术研究还是日常办公,这款工具都能帮你构建高效的信息管理系统,让工作更专注、思维更清晰。现在就尝试安装,体验Linux桌面环境中这款高效的信息管理利器吧!
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0187
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0112
Step-3.7-FlashStep-3.7-Flash是一个拥有 1980 亿参数的稀疏混合专家(MoE)视觉语言模型,由 1960 亿参数的语言主干网络和 18 亿参数的视觉编码器组合而成,具备原生图像理解能力。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
omega-aiOmega-AI:基于java打造的深度学习框架,帮助你快速搭建神经网络,实现模型推理与训练,引擎支持自动求导,多线程与GPU运算,GPU支持CUDA,CUDNN。Java03
llm-universe本项目是一个面向小白开发者的大模型应用开发教程,在线阅读地址:https://datawhalechina.github.io/llm-universe/Jupyter Notebook08